if you do it the way revels says then it won't have all your ratings playlists etc. You will have to copy the text file from the itunes folder to the new pc.
 
  Megane
How big is your library? Can be done easily using an external drive or networked PCs

Just move the itunes folder from Music into new PC and keep all the music in the same place.

Open iTunes and it wont know any different
